Chapter Commentary — Colossians 3
Chapter Overview

Chapter Overview

Colossians 3 presents the practical outworking of the believer's union with Christ. Having established in chapters 1–2 that Christ is supreme and complete, Paul now shows how this doctrine transforms daily living. The chapter divides into two major movements: first, a call to put off the old life of sin and put on the new life of Christ (verses 1–11), and second, concrete instructions for Christian relationships in the home and workplace (verses 12–25). Throughout, Paul anchors all Christian conduct to our heavenly position in Christ and our future resurrection with Him.

Verses 1–4: Your Heavenly Position and Future Hope

Paul begins by reminding believers of a foundational reality: you have been raised with Christ. This is not future possibility but present spiritual fact. Because this is true, the logical command follows: seek those things which are above (verse 1). The word "seek" means to pursue intentionally and passionately. Our affections—what we love and desire—must align with our heavenly citizenship, not earthly pursuits (verse 2).

Why? Because ye are dead (verse 3). The believer has died to sin's dominion through identification with Christ's death. Our true life is now "hid with Christ in God"—hidden in the sense of secure, safe, and hidden from the accusations of Satan. This present hiddenness will become glorious visibility when Christ returns (verse 4): we shall appear with Him in glory. This future hope—our physical resurrection and eternal life in Christ's presence—should motivate us today to live heavenward rather than earthward.

Application: Ask yourself: What dominates my thoughts and desires? Are they earthly or heavenly? Paul invites us to live consciously as people who belong to another kingdom, whose ultimate citizenship is not here but in God's kingdom.

Verses 5–11: Put Off the Old Man, Put On the New

Because you are raised with Christ, you must mortify (put to death) sinful behaviors: sexual sin, uncleanness, lustful desires, and covetousness—which Paul strikingly identifies as idolatry (verse 5). Covetousness is idolatry because the coveting heart worships and serves the desired object rather than God. Such sins provoke God's wrath (verse 6), and believers must recognize they once walked in these things (verse 7).

But now comes the decisive word: put off all these (verse 8). Anger, malice, blasphemy, and filthy speech must be abandoned. We are to lie not one to another (verse 9) because we have put off the old man and put on the new man—the renewed self, renewed in knowledge after the image of him that created him (verse 10). This new humanity transcends every human division (verse 11): Greek, Jew, circumcised, uncircumcised, barbarian, Scythian, bond, or free. Christ is all, and in all—Christ is the source, substance, and unifying reality of the new creation.

Application: Practical holiness is not merely behavior modification; it is a putting off and putting on rooted in our new identity. When tempted to sin, remember: this is not who you are anymore in Christ.

Verses 12–17: The New Life in Action

As the elect of God, holy and beloved, believers are to clothe themselves with Christian virtues: mercies, kindness, humility, meekness, and longsuffering (verse 12). Forgiveness is paramount—even as Christ forgave you, so also do ye (verse 13). Above all, charity (love) binds everything together as the bond of completeness (verse 14). Let the peace of God rule in your hearts (verse 15), and be thankful. Let Christ's word dwell in you richly through teaching and admonishing via psalms and hymns (verse 16). Whatever you do, do it in the name of the Lord Jesus, giving thanks (verse 17).

Application: These verses show that Christian maturity is marked by love, peace, thankfulness, and Christ-centered speech. Pursue these virtues intentionally.

Verses 18–25: Christian Household and Work Relations

Paul now applies these principles to specific relationships. Wives are to submit to husbands; husbands to love wives sacrificially (verses 18–19). Children obey parents; fathers refrain from harshness (verses 20–21). Servants (workers) obey masters wholeheartedly, not merely for show, but in singleness of heart, fearing God, knowing they serve the Lord Christ (verses 22–24). This theology elevates work itself: we serve Jesus in our labor. Wrongdoing will be judged fairly; God shows no respect of persons (verse 25).
